Changing Your Settings 387
•Smart alert
: Once enabled, pickup the device to be alerted and notified
of you have missed any calls or messages.
Double tap to top
: Once enabled, double tap the top of the device to be
taken to the top of the current on-screen list.
Tilt to zoom
: Once enabled, you must be on a screen where content
can be zoomed. In a single motion, touch and hold two points on the
display then tilt the device back and forth to zoom in or out.
Pan to move icon
: Once enabled, touch and hold a desired application
shortcut icon or widget on the screen. Once it detaches, move the
device left or right to migrate it to a new location.
Pan to browse images
: Once enabled, touch and hold a desired on-
screen image to pan around it. Move the device left or right to pan
vertically or up and down to pan horizontally around the large on-screen
image.
Shake to update
: Once enabled, shake your device to rescan for
Bluetooth devices, rescan for Wi-Fi devices, Refresh a Web page, etc.
Turn over to mute/pause
: Once enabled, mute incoming calls and any
playing sounds by turning the device over display down on a surface.
This is the opposite of the pickup to be notified gesture.
Sensitivity settings and tutorial
: Allows you to access the sensitivity
settings for the currently active gesture (page 388).
Learn about motions
: Provides on-screen descriptions for the motion
functionality.
